What is a San Jose Chapter 13 bankruptcy?
Also called the wage earner’s plan, Chapter 13 is a form of bankruptcy for individuals to pay off debt through installments over a three or five-year period. This type of bankruptcy is appropriate even if the individual is a sole proprietor, has a partnership, or is operating an unincorporated business. A debtor must have a reliable source of income to file for Chapter 13, with the capability of making future payments to creditors. For debtors making more than the California median income, a five-year repayment plan usually applies as opposed to a three-year plan.
The amount of debt limits eligibility for Chapter 13. Under the U.S. Bankruptcy code, an individual may file for Chapter 13 if debt amounts fall within these limits:
§ Unsecured debts less than $336, 900
§ Secured debts less than $1,010,650
Advantages that Chapter 13 in San Jose provides
Many of the reasons debtors choose Chapter 13 to handle insolvency include:
§ Ability to stop foreclosure provided that delinquent mortgage payments are made during the three or five-year plan
§ Rescheduling of secured debt with possible lower payments
§ Protection of co-signers
§ No direct creditor contract
§ Trustee management of creditor payment under a re-payment schedule that works much like a loan consolidation plan
§ Automatic stay that prevents creditors from pursuing collection efforts
§ Ability to retain property during the repayment time period
